КАТЕГОРИИ: Архитектура-(3434)Астрономия-(809)Биология-(7483)Биотехнологии-(1457)Военное дело-(14632)Высокие технологии-(1363)География-(913)Геология-(1438)Государство-(451)Демография-(1065)Дом-(47672)Журналистика и СМИ-(912)Изобретательство-(14524)Иностранные языки-(4268)Информатика-(17799)Искусство-(1338)История-(13644)Компьютеры-(11121)Косметика-(55)Кулинария-(373)Культура-(8427)Лингвистика-(374)Литература-(1642)Маркетинг-(23702)Математика-(16968)Машиностроение-(1700)Медицина-(12668)Менеджмент-(24684)Механика-(15423)Науковедение-(506)Образование-(11852)Охрана труда-(3308)Педагогика-(5571)Полиграфия-(1312)Политика-(7869)Право-(5454)Приборостроение-(1369)Программирование-(2801)Производство-(97182)Промышленность-(8706)Психология-(18388)Религия-(3217)Связь-(10668)Сельское хозяйство-(299)Социология-(6455)Спорт-(42831)Строительство-(4793)Торговля-(5050)Транспорт-(2929)Туризм-(1568)Физика-(3942)Философия-(17015)Финансы-(26596)Химия-(22929)Экология-(12095)Экономика-(9961)Электроника-(8441)Электротехника-(4623)Энергетика-(12629)Юриспруденция-(1492)Ядерная техника-(1748) |
Построение объемных фигур с помощью функции Polyhedron
CreateMesh(F, s0, s1, t0, t1, sgrid, tgrid, fmap) Применение новой функции CreateMesh
Еще одна новинка системы Mathcad 2000, отсутствующая в предшествующих версиях, это новая графическая функция для задания поверхностей: Эта функция возвращает массив из трех матриц, представляющих координаты переменных x, y и z для функции F, определенной в векторной параметрической форме в качестве параметров sgrid и tgrid. Параметры s0, s1, t0, t1 задают пределы изменения переменных sgrid и tgrid. Параметр fmap - трехэлементный вектор значений, задающий число линий в сетке изображаемой функции. Все аргументы F не обязательны. Создаваеиый функцией CreateMesh массив можно использовать для ввода в шаблон трехмерной графики типа Surface Plot. Пример применения функции CreateMesh - построение объемной фигуры, которая получается вращением кривой, заданной функцией f(х), вокруг оси Х или Y. На рис.8.23 показан пример решения данной задачи. Слева на рис.8.23 показана исходная кривая, заданная функцией f(x), а справа дано построение объемной фигуры с применением форматирования для повышения наглядности графика. Рисунок 8.23 - Получение объемной фигуры, полученной вращением кривой
В Mathcad 2000 Professional появилась новая функция для построения объемных фигур полиэдров:
Polyhedron(“name”), где name - имя фигуры. Имя ряда фигур можно задавать в виде “#N”, где N – номер фигуры. Пример построения приведен на рис. 8.24.
Name:=”cube”
Рисунок 8.24 - Пример построения куба
Построенная фигура может форматироваться как и другие графики поверхности, а также вращаться, приближаться и удаляться с помощью мыши.
8 .4.3 Функция задания полиэдров PolyLookup
Для описания произвольных полиэдров в Mathcad 2000 Professional служит функция PolyLookup, которую можно задать одним из следующих способов:
PolyLookup(“имя") PolyLookup(“#N”) Ро1уLооkuр(“0писатель”)
Аргументом функции является строка с именем, номером фигуры или с ее описателем в случае создания составных полиэдров. Всего в таблице имеется около 60 полиэдров. Большое число примеров применения функции PolyLookup можно найти в справочной системе Matchad 2000 – раздел Polyhedra таблиц Reference Table, одна страница которой приведена на рис.8.25
Рисунок 8.25 - Страница таблиц, посвященная полиэдрам
Дата добавления: 2014-11-29; Просмотров: 1094; Нарушение авторских прав?; Мы поможем в написании вашей работы! Нам важно ваше мнение! Был ли полезен опубликованный материал? Да | Нет |